how golf scope measure distance?
just saw from a website http://www.sourcingmap.com/professional-electronic-golf-range-finder-golf-scope-silver-p-2565.html
claims that “the Golf Range Finder s precision optical instrument designed to find the distance between you and the flag. ”
It is not actually a laser range finder, it counts on the height of the flag stick. There are 2 lines in the view finder, a top and a bottom. By clicking a button, the top line drops down a little bit with each click. You need to line up the bottom line with the bottom of the flag stick and the top line with the top of the flag stick. By assuming that all flag sticks are of equal height, it calculates how far away you are from the hole. You need to be at a spot that you can see the bottom of the pin or this range finder won’t work. If you play a course that has a shorter stick than normal, it won’t be much good to you either.
I got that exact range finder a couple of years ago and hated it. The batteries don’t last very long and if you are below the green and can’t see the bottom of the pin, it’s worthless. I would not recommend getting that type of range finder, you won’t be happy. I had to go out and spend more money to get a real laser range finder and no longer use the range finder in question. They also make a range finder like the one in question that doesn’t use batteries. It has all the lines printed on the screen for a number of different yardages on it. You line up the bottom of the flag with the bottom line (just the same way the range finder in question does) and use the top line that comes closest to the top of the pin for your distance. The range finder in question only gives you 1 top line at a time and shows you the distance to that particular line, that the reason for the batteries & the one with out batteries gives you all lines and distances at the same time, you just need to tpick out the top line that best fits your distance.
